Что означают испытательные среды

Что означают испытательные среды

Испытательные инфраструктуры образуют как изолированные среды, при каких оценивается действие цифрового обеспечения до этого продукта использования при главной платформе. Такие среды формируются для того, чтобы находить сбои, анализировать поведение сервиса и проверять правильность обновлений без вероятности для устойчивой эксплуатации сервиса. Подобные окружения имитируют параметры рабочей эксплуатации, однако совсем не Гет Икс воздействуют на клиентов и главные процессы.

Во ходе создания проверочные инфраструктуры занимают значимую функцию. Полезные ресурсы, подобные как гет икс, помогают понять структуру окружений плюс основы таких окружений использования. Основное значение отводится точности воспроизведения параметров, надежности эксплуатации и возможности контролируемого проверки разных сценариев.

Назначение проверочных окружений

Главная функция тестовой инфраструктуры — обеспечить контролируемое окружение ради валидации обновлений. Каждая дополнительная опция, исправление сбоя либо изменение сервиса сначала тестируется во отдельном окружении. Данное помогает обнаружить сбои перед периода, пока эти проблемы воздействуют при главную платформу.

Испытательные инфраструктуры дополнительно используются с целью оценки взаимодействия. Программа может взаимодействовать через базами данных, сторонними службами а также локальными модулями. Во тестовой среде получается понять, когда все компоненты работают Get X корректно параллельно.

Кроме того одной задачей выступает измерение эффективности. В проверочном окружении создается нагрузка, чтобы понять, каким образом система проявляет работу при большом количестве запросов. Данное помогает обнаружить узкие места и сначала настроиться под повышению использования.

Виды испытательных сред

Используется несколько категорий тестовых инфраструктур. Разработка чаще всего запускается во местной области, в которой инженер валидирует конкретные правки. Такая инфраструктура выделяется значительной подвижностью а также дает возможность быстро делать правки.

Очередным этапом становится интеграционная среда. Здесь оценивается связь разных компонентов системы. Основная задача — убедиться, если компоненты корректно обмениваются сведениями и никак не вызывают ошибок.

Staging-среда максимально подведена к боевой. При данном контуре валидируется итоговая сборка продукта до публикацией. Такое дает возможность измерить поведение сервиса в условиях, приближенных до рабочим.

Дополнительно может задействоваться самостоятельная инфраструктура с целью нагрузочного проверки. Во данном контуре формируется значительная нагрузка, дабы проверить стабильность платформы плюс ее способность обрабатывать большое количество обращений.

Структура испытательной среды

Испытательная область содержит ряд частей. Основу создает стенд либо кластер серверов, в которых запускается приложение. Также задействуются системы данных, решения размещения плюс сетевые Гет Икс модули.

Параметры среды может соответствовать фактическим параметрам. Это касается версий программного софта, настроек машин и структуры данных. Насколько точнее инфраструктура имитирует продуктовую платформу, тем надежнее итоги тестирования.

Кроме того могут задействоваться тестовые данные. Эти наборы имитируют рабочие записи, однако не включают конфиденциальной сведений. Данные материалы дают возможность валидировать схему функционирования сервиса без вероятности раскрытия данных.

Администрирование данными при проверочной среде

Обращение через сведениями требует особого подхода. В проверочной области применяются копии а также отдельно сформированные массивы Get X данных. Данное помогает повторять различные сценарии плюс валидировать работу сервиса в различных условиях.

Следует отслеживать свежесть данных. В случае если сведения обновлялась давно, результаты валидации могут являться ошибочными. Следовательно сведения постоянно актуализируются или генерируются заново.

Кроме того важно принимать защиту. Проверочные данные совсем не должны содержать реальную частную сведения. С целью такого задействуются методы анонимизации и GetX создания синтетических данных.

Механизация испытательных окружений

Новые инструменты разработки регулярно применяют механизацию. Испытательные окружения могут создаваться плюс конфигурироваться самостоятельно. Такое помогает своевременно запускать контур для валидации правок.

Автообработка предполагает конфигурацию серверов, установку зависимостей плюс передачу данных. Подобный подход уменьшает вероятность ошибок а также облегчает цикл проверки.

Дополнительно упрощается устранение и актуализация инфраструктуры. Затем прохождения валидации среда имеет возможность быть очищено либо развернуто повторно. Это сохраняет устойчивость а также исключает увеличение сбоев Гет Икс.

Связь с CI/CD процессами

Проверочные окружения тесно объединены по CI/CD. Во время очередном обновлении проекта программно запускаются процессы, что используют тестовые среды с целью валидации. Такое дает возможность своевременно находить сбои а также исключать их попадание дальше.

Любой шаг CI/CD имеет возможность задействовать отдельную среду. Так, межкомпонентные проверки проводятся при отдельной инфраструктуре, и финальная валидация — в отдельной. Данный метод увеличивает устойчивость платформы.

Самостоятельное обращение через проверочными инфраструктурами делает механизм разработки намного понятным. Каждые обновления выполняют единую последовательность валидаций.

Оценка стабильности

Контроль стабильности становится главной функцией испытательных инфраструктур. В них запускаются многообразные типы проверки: сценарное, межкомпонентное, производительное плюс контрольное. Отдельный формат проверки оценивает определенный элемент действия сервиса.

Результаты валидации записываются а также оцениваются. Когда обнаружены сбои, обновления передаются на доработку. Это исключает попадание проблем GetX во рабочую среду.

Постоянное проверка дает возможность обеспечивать устойчивость платформы. Даже при небольшие изменения способны повлиять на функционирование сервиса, следовательно валидация проводится постоянно.

Распространенные проблемы при использовании тестовых инфраструктур

Первой из типичных ошибок становится расхождение среды реальным параметрам. В случае если конфигурация расходится, результаты проверки способны оказаться недостоверными. Данное приводит к дефектам затем запуска.

Также другой сложностью становится применение старых данных. Во таком случае валидация не отражает Гет Икс реальную ситуацию, и проблемы способны оказаться невыявленными.

Кроме того встречается недостаточная отделенность. Если тестовая среда объединена по боевой платформой, возникает угроза влияния при рабочие записи. Это может создать путь к критическим инцидентам.

Защита испытательных окружений

Тестовые окружения обязаны оказаться закрыты аналогично же образом, аналогично плюс продуктовые системы. Эти окружения способны хранить важную сведения о архитектуре программы плюс этого продукта схеме. Потому обращение Get X в ним должен оказаться ограничен.

Применяются механизмы ограничения доступа, шифрования плюс контроля. Такое помогает исключить постороннее подключение инфраструктуры.

Дополнительно следует контролировать по актуализацией цифрового софта. Устаревшие компоненты способны включать уязвимости, какие способны быть использованы посторонними лицами GetX.

Контроль испытательных сред

Контроль позволяет отслеживать состояние проверочной области. Данный механизм демонстрирует загрузку ресурсов, дефекты и скорость. Такое дает возможность обнаруживать сбои не лишь во программе, но также во самой области.

Периодическое наблюдение дает возможность обеспечивать стабильность окружения. В случае если ресурсы исчерпываются а также возникают сбои, это имеет возможность повлиять на выводы тестирования.

Контроль также помогает настраивать распределение ресурсов. Это особенно существенно при взаимодействии с несколькими окружениями параллельно.

Дополнительные аспекты испытательных окружений

Ключевым среди значимых аспектов становится контроль редакциями среды. Разные этапы разработки способны требовать различных параметров плюс условий. Следовательно Get X необходимо фиксировать условия окружения плюс контролировать правки. Данное дает возможность повторять параметры проверки плюс предотвращать несовпадений среди выводами.

Кроме того задействуется метод краткосрочных окружений. Для отдельной задачи а также проверки формируется изолированная область, что удаляется по завершении завершения процесса. Такое помогает валидировать правки самостоятельно и уменьшает риск конфликтов между различными редакциями сервиса.

Еще одним элементом является связь по средствами разработки. Проверочные окружения имеют возможность автоматически GetX подключаться к платформам контроля релизов, CI/CD пайплайнам а также средствам мониторинга. Это формирует цикл валидации гораздо удобным а также удобным.

Оптимизация применения проверочных сред

Для результативной эксплуатации важно контролировать средства. Развертывание а также поддержка инфраструктуры требует вычислительных ресурсов, следовательно следует отслеживать эти ресурсы расход. Автоматическое деактивация ненужных сред позволяет Гет Икс сократить нагрузку.

Настройка также включает настройку процессов. Далеко не каждые валидации обязаны проводиться во единой среде. Распределение проверок между окружениями повышает скорость проверку а также снижает время ожидания.

Постоянный анализ работы проверочных окружений позволяет выявлять слабые места. Если операции выполняются долго а также регулярно возникают дефекты, параметры нужно корректировать. Это формирует инфраструктуру гораздо надежной а также быстрой Get X.

Прикладное значение тестовых окружений

Тестовые окружения задействуются на разных этапах разработки. Эти окружения помогают обнаруживать сбои, проверять правки плюс повышать качество сервиса. При отсутствии данных инфраструктур вероятность сбоев при продуктовой инфраструктуре значительно возрастает.

Корректно организованные испытательные окружения создают цикл программирования более понятным. Любое изменение получает валидацию, это сокращает частоту неожиданных сбоев.

Понимание механизмов использования тестовых инфраструктур дает возможность глубже понимать при актуальных технологиях создания. Это GetX дает представление про том, как разрабатываются, тестируются плюс публикуются онлайн сервисы.

Tinggalkan Balasan

Alamat email Anda tidak akan dipublikasikan. Ruas yang wajib ditandai *